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Nebraska Chinese Association showing financial trends over 9 years of public records:

Over 9 years of IRS 990 filings (2015–2023), Nebraska Chinese Association's revenue has grown by 26.7%, moving from $126K to $159K. Total assets increased by 245.3% over the same period, from $162K to $559K. Total functional expenses rose by 342.2%, from $25K to $109K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Nebraska Chinese Association reported a surplus of $50K, with revenue exceeding expenses.

YearRevenueExpensesAssetsLiabilitiesOfficer Comp. %PDF
2023 $159K $109K $559K $0 View 990
2022 $124K $105K $583K $74K View 990
2021 $118K $85K $625K $135K View 990
2020 $221K $169K $619K $163K View 990
2019 $182K $156K $601K $196K View 990
2018 $190K $104K $646K $267K View 990
2017 $193K $108K $638K $345K View 990
2016 $112K $71K $642K $439K View 990
2015 $126K $25K $162K $0 View 990
